Residential Energy Auditing and Evaluation Services
A Home Energy Auditor or Evaluator systematically examines a home to identify areas of energy waste. This methodical process includes data collection, diagnostic testing, analysis, and the creation of a prioritized recommendations report. Many evaluators in the region offer EnerGuide ratings or similar scoring systems to illustrate current performance and anticipated improvements.
Typical assessment domains are:
- Heating systems: furnace/boiler efficiency, distribution losses, and heat pump performance.
- Cooling and ventilation: ductwork integrity, air conditioning loads, and evaluation of heat recovery ventilators (HRVs/ERVs).
- Insulation and air sealing: reviewing walls, attics, basements, and usual leak-prone spots around windows and doors.
- Building envelope and windows: glazing type, condition of frames, and shading effectiveness.
- Controls and lighting: evaluating thermostats, zoning configurations, and LED lighting upgrades.
Standard diagnostic tests involve:
- Visual assessments and utility usage evaluations.
- Blower door testing to gauge air leakage.
- Using thermal imaging to uncover cold areas or absent insulation.
- Combustion safety inspections and ventilation checks.
- Energy modelling to project savings.

Building Code Compliance and Advisory Services
A Building Code Compliance Consultant plays a pivotal role in navigating British Columbia’s building codes. New constructions and major renovations are required to adhere to energy and safety standards as outlined in the BC Building Code and the BC Energy Step Code. A compliance consultant confirms that design and documentation align with the standards before permits are approved.
The services usually comprise:
- Evaluating design drawings and engineering blueprints to ensure code compliance.
- Creating energy modelling reports and step-code analyses.
- Arranging required testing and inspections (including blower door, airtightness, and mechanical commissioning checks).
- Communicating with municipal permit officers in West Kelowna, Westbank First Nation, and Kelowna to expedite question resolution.
- Assembling compliance packages that help reduce permit delays and eliminate expensive rework.
Active compliance measures reduce delays and costs. For instance, identifying an HVAC sizing mistake during the design phase of a Shannon Lake renovation avoids on-site change orders and maintains project timelines. A consultant serves as the technical liaison among designers, contractors, and municipal reviewers.

Sustainable Approaches and Environmental Consulting
An Environmental Consultant enhances energy advising by expanding the focus from mere energy usage to overall environmental impact. The role evaluates building materials, lifecycle impacts, and unique site considerations, essential for developers and homeowners in areas such as Goats Peak or Westbank’s riverfront.
Frequently suggested eco-friendly practices:
- Using low-embodied-energy and recycled materials for renovation projects.
- Adopting renewable energy options including rooftop solar panels, solar hot water systems, and battery storage.
- Designing for passive solar gain and natural ventilation to reduce reliance on mechanical systems.
- Choosing durable materials to minimize future waste and maintenance costs.
Green certifications commonly pursued include:
- Built Green BC
- Passive House and Passive House Classic
- LEED or ENERGY STAR for new constructions and major projects
An environmental approach also enhances resilience. For example, combining solar PV, battery storage, and a heat pump ensures energy security during power outages and cuts reliance on grid peak power—an advantage in diverse communities from Westbank Centre to Peachland.
